Direct (nonstop) flights from Guangzhou to Penang
2 airlines fly nonstop from Guangzhou Baiyun International Airport (CAN) to Penang International (PEN). It's 1,517 miles (2,442 km), about 4h in the air. Operated by Spring Airlines, China Southern Airlines.

How far is Guangzhou from Penang?
The flight distance from Guangzhou to Penang is 1,517 miles (2,442 km), measured as the great-circle (shortest air) distance. That's roughly the same distance as New York to Miami.
